What does a manufacturing intern do?

A Manufacturing Intern typically works alongside engineers and production staff to learn about manufacturing processes, quality control, and equipment operation. Their responsibilities may include assisting with process improvement projects, collecting and analyzing production data, and helping to ensure products meet quality standards. Interns gain hands-on experience in a factory or plant environment, developing skills in problem-solving and teamwork. This role is ideal for students or recent graduates interested in a career in manufacturing or industrial engineering.

What types of projects or tasks can a manufacturing intern expect to work on during their internship?

Manufacturing Interns often participate in hands-on projects such as process improvement initiatives, data collection and analysis for production efficiency, and assisting with quality control measures. They may also support engineering teams in troubleshooting equipment, preparing reports, and implementing lean manufacturing techniques. Interns frequently collaborate with operators, engineers, and supervisors, gaining exposure to various stages of the manufacturing process and learning industry best practices. This practical experience helps interns build technical skills and understand the workflow within a manufacturing environment.

What is the difference between Manufacturing Intern vs Manufacturing Technician?

AspectManufacturing InternManufacturing Technician
Required CredentialsTypically pursuing or recent graduate in engineering, manufacturing, or related fieldHigh school diploma or equivalent; technical cert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entEntry-level, supervised, learning-focused environment in manufacturing facilitiesHands-on, operational environment with direct equipment and process responsibilities
Employer & Industry UsageInternships offered by manufacturing companies for training and experienceFull-time or part-time roles in manufacturing plants for process support and maintenance

In summary, a Manufacturing Intern is a learning position aimed at gaining industry experience, while a Manufacturing Technician is a more experienced role responsible for maintaining and operating manufacturing equipment.

What is a manufacturing intern?

A manufacturing intern is a student or entry-level worker who assists in production processes within a manufacturing facility. They typically gain hands-on experience with equipment, quality control, and safety procedures while supporting ongoing operations, often under supervision and with a focus on learning industry skills.

Job Summary:

The Accounting internship will be based in our De Pere, WI office, and will be responsible for applying accounting principles to assist in the completion of the Company's month-end closing process, preparation of financial reports, analysis of financial results, and support of process improvements. This position will be directly involved in one or more special projects.

In addition to hands-on experience in Accounting, this position will provide the intern with:

  • Formal orientation and on-boarding
  • Individualized development and feedback
  • Regular interface with Finance leadership through 'Lessons from Leaders' sessions
  • Exposure to one or more of our manufacturing and/or distribution operations
  • Organizational and time management skills in managing daily and project work
  • Experience working with SAP, a large ERP system
  • Networking opportunities
  • Presentation skills in providing presentation to the Chief Financial Officer and the Finance Leadership Team
